Thanks for taking the time to visit my JustGiving page.

Many of you will know that I was diagnosed with breast cancer in March 2008. At the end of my treatment my lovely Mum died. My friend Marian Derham went to BCC's fashion show in October 2008 and rang me the following day to tell me how impressed she was by the event and that she wanted to see me up on the catwalk the following year! Wow, what a challenge...but boy, do I love a challenge. 

So, here I am. I was fortunate to have been chosen by BCC for this year's show at the Grosvenor House Hotel on Park Lane, London W1. My mum, Betty Smithers, was a fashion lecturer and historian who had a passion for fashion, colour and style. She was also a fantastic mum. I am modelling in her memory, knowing that she would have been so proud of me and I know that she would have approved of the fund-raising being done in this way for a very good cause.
